Japan to provide Ukraine with $3.6-mln for humanitarian needs
Journal Staff Report

KYIV, Feb 19 – Japan is to provide Ukraine with $3.6 million for humanitarian needs to support vulnerable parts of the population and restore eastern regions of the country, Japanese Ambassador to Ukraine Shigeki Sumi has said.

"Japan will provide nearly $4 million in 2018," Sumi said on Monday during a press conference.

He said the money would be spent on radio equipment for the Interior Ministry, the rebuilding of housing, purchase of medical equipment and training for persons from eastern regions of the country.
